On Saturday, September 26, the National Testing Agency conducted the All India Law Entrance Test (AILET) for 2020. This year's trend was virtually identical to the previous year. The AILET 2020 Question Paper was moderately difficult to complete and rather lengthy.

AILET 2020 Question Paper

The AILET 2020 Question Paper had 150 questions that needed to be answered in 90 minutes, with one mark awarded for each valid response and 0.25 deducted for each erroneous answer.

The exam was given online at more than 100 locations, however, students encountered a number of technical issues, including automatic submission of their work ahead of schedule, frequent screen blanking, computer malfunctions, and other issues of a similar nature. The paper's general feel ranged from mild to rough. The legal part of the document was long.

Section-Wise AILET 2020 Exam Analysis

Section I - English

  • The English segment was both moderate and lengthy. As a result, time and accuracy management were critical for this section of the article.

  • The portion was mostly composed of sentence correction, reading comprehension, and vocabulary-based problems.

  • Sentence completion questions were simple to moderate and may have been finished in less time.

  • The sentence repair questions were simple to answer because they were based on basic grammatical principles.

  • The reading comprehension was slightly difficult (content-wise), and the questions based on it had close responses.

  • This time, the vocabulary and idiom/phrase problems varied from moderate to difficult.

  • There were no questions regarding a figure of speech.

Section II - General Knowledge

  • This section was dominated by current events questions (20 out of 35), which were manageable for anyone with access to a respectable newspaper.

  • The topics covered in the questions were awards and sports, science and social science, business, and the economy.

  • Overall, the segment was feasible, and attempting 25 or more would be judged realistic.

Section III - Legal Aptitude

  • The Legal Aptitude component of the AILET 2020 Question Paper was assessed as hard.

  • 17 of the 35 questions were on legal knowledge, while 18 were for legal reasoning (principles).

  • The Legal Knowledge-based questions mostly included current legal information, such as CAA, new ordinances, and anti-defection laws.

  • The legal reasoning questions were lengthy and complex, with a focus on contract and tort law.

Section IV - Logical Reasoning

  • The AILET 2020 Question Paper, portion included questions about all of the main topics, such as arrangements, codes, and instructions.

  • The blood relation enquiries were based on the family tree, which was simple. Given the time constraints, the ease of this phase may have aided in maximising the number of attempts.

Section V - Mathematics

  • Aside from fundamental arithmetic problems such as average, profit and loss, SI and CI, and percentage, there were also questions about permutation, probability, equations, and other topics.

  • The selection of questions needed to be quick.

  • A score of 5-6 is regarded as satisfactory in this segment.
